Where this word comes from
Inherited from Old Swedish lēþer, from Old Norse leiðr, from Proto-Germanic *laiþaz, from Proto-Indo-European *h₂leyt-.

Where this word comes from
Inherited from Old Swedish lēþ, from Old Norse leið, from Proto-Germanic *laidō.

Where this word comes from
Inherited from Old Swedish liþer, from Old Norse liðr, from Proto-Germanic *liþuz.
